Hi Bob,
MRL map is a version 1.3. To make it work in TS2009 (scenery and buildings), you would have to save this map in TRS2006, which will bring it to version 2.6 if I am not mistaken. You could then import it in TS2009 and everything should be ok. I did this for the Tehachapi route (which was also at version 1.3) and everything works fine in TS2009.
